HD HYUNDAI POWER TRANSFORMERS H-1B salaries (2026)

Yes — HD HYUNDAI POWER TRANSFORMERS sponsors H-1B workers. Across 4 certified Labor Condition Applications, the median offered base wage is $57,435. Every figure below comes straight from the employer's own filings with the U.S. Department of Labor.

Certified H-1B filings

HD HYUNDAI POWER TRANSFORMERS filed 4 certified H-1B labor condition applications across 1 state between Apr 2025 and Mar 2026. The median offered base wage was $57,435.

Wage-level distribution

DOL prevailing-wage levels reflect the seniority the employer certified, from Level I (entry) to Level IV (fully competent).
